Output 43bf65b29f5b23e3a011d1d3727bdfd42d32a760396d90997d5e09f3f972d768:1

value
1289742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 189733fa41c9cae764071f02bfa7171623d57a8b OP_EQUAL
address
33w3GvFRqZdjLfAFmv1uysuDdPZDAVKZPk
transaction
43bf65b29f5b23e3a011d1d3727bdfd42d32a760396d90997d5e09f3f972d768
confirmations
79949
spent
true